Pop-under Ads Explained: The Basics You Need to Know
Pop-under ads are a type of digital promotion that appear in a new browser instance beneath the current web platform when a user clicks on a link. These ads typically remain hidden until the user clicks away the primary website, at which point they become visible. They are often disliked for being intrusive and disruptive, but they can also be an effective way to reach users who are already interested in a particular topic or category.

Pop-Under Ads: How They Work and Why They're Used
Pop-under ads are a type of online advertising. These ads appear as a secondary tab when a user clicks on a link. Unlike pop-up High-converting popunders ads, which take center stage, pop-under ads load passively in the background.
